Home
last modified time | relevance | path

Searched refs:Api (Results 1 - 25 of 68) sorted by relevance

123

/third_party/rust/crates/cxx/gen/cmd/src/gen/
H A Dnamespace.rs2 use crate::syntax::Api;
4 impl Api { impls
7 Api::CxxFunction(efn) | Api::RustFunction(efn) => &efn.name.namespace, in namespace()
8 Api::CxxType(ety) | Api::RustType(ety) => &ety.name.namespace, in namespace()
9 Api::Enum(enm) => &enm.name.namespace, in namespace()
10 Api::Struct(strct) => &strct.name.namespace, in namespace()
11 Api::Impl(_) | Api in namespace()
[all...]
H A Dcfg.rs4 use crate::syntax::Api;
24 apis: &mut Vec<Api>,
29 Api::Struct(strct) => strct
32 Api::Enum(enm) => enm
111 impl Api { impls
114 Api::Include(include) => &include.cfg, in cfg()
115 Api::Struct(strct) => &strct.cfg, in cfg()
116 Api::Enum(enm) => &enm.cfg, in cfg()
117 Api::CxxType(ety) | Api in cfg()
[all...]
H A Dnested.rs2 use crate::syntax::Api;
6 direct: Vec<&'a Api>,
11 pub fn new(apis: Vec<&'a Api>) -> Self { in new()
15 pub fn direct_content(&self) -> &[&'a Api] { in new()
24 fn sort_by_inner_namespace(apis: Vec<&Api>, depth: usize) -> NamespaceEntries { in sort_by_inner_namespace()
57 use crate::syntax::{Api, Doc, ExternType, ForeignName, Lang, Lifetimes, Pair};
121 fn assert_ident(api: &Api, expected: &str) { in assert_ident()
122 if let Api::CxxType(cxx_type) = api { in assert_ident()
129 fn make_api(ns: Option<&str>, ident: &str) -> Api { in make_api()
131 Api in make_api()
[all...]
/third_party/rust/crates/cxx/gen/src/
H A Dnamespace.rs2 use crate::syntax::Api;
4 impl Api { impls
7 Api::CxxFunction(efn) | Api::RustFunction(efn) => &efn.name.namespace, in namespace()
8 Api::CxxType(ety) | Api::RustType(ety) => &ety.name.namespace, in namespace()
9 Api::Enum(enm) => &enm.name.namespace, in namespace()
10 Api::Struct(strct) => &strct.name.namespace, in namespace()
11 Api::Impl(_) | Api in namespace()
[all...]
H A Dcfg.rs4 use crate::syntax::Api;
24 apis: &mut Vec<Api>,
29 Api::Struct(strct) => strct
32 Api::Enum(enm) => enm
111 impl Api { impls
114 Api::Include(include) => &include.cfg, in cfg()
115 Api::Struct(strct) => &strct.cfg, in cfg()
116 Api::Enum(enm) => &enm.cfg, in cfg()
117 Api::CxxType(ety) | Api in cfg()
[all...]
H A Dnested.rs2 use crate::syntax::Api;
6 direct: Vec<&'a Api>,
11 pub fn new(apis: Vec<&'a Api>) -> Self { in new()
15 pub fn direct_content(&self) -> &[&'a Api] { in new()
24 fn sort_by_inner_namespace(apis: Vec<&Api>, depth: usize) -> NamespaceEntries { in sort_by_inner_namespace()
57 use crate::syntax::{Api, Doc, ExternType, ForeignName, Lang, Lifetimes, Pair};
121 fn assert_ident(api: &Api, expected: &str) { in assert_ident()
122 if let Api::CxxType(cxx_type) = api { in assert_ident()
129 fn make_api(ns: Option<&str>, ident: &str) -> Api { in make_api()
131 Api in make_api()
[all...]
H A Dcheck.rs3 use crate::syntax::{error, Api};
9 pub(super) fn precheck(cx: &mut Errors, apis: &[Api], opt: &Opt) {
15 fn check_dot_includes(cx: &mut Errors, apis: &[Api]) { in check_dot_includes()
17 if let Api::Include(include) = api { in check_dot_includes()
/third_party/rust/crates/cxx/gen/lib/src/gen/
H A Dnamespace.rs2 use crate::syntax::Api;
4 impl Api { impls
7 Api::CxxFunction(efn) | Api::RustFunction(efn) => &efn.name.namespace, in namespace()
8 Api::CxxType(ety) | Api::RustType(ety) => &ety.name.namespace, in namespace()
9 Api::Enum(enm) => &enm.name.namespace, in namespace()
10 Api::Struct(strct) => &strct.name.namespace, in namespace()
11 Api::Impl(_) | Api in namespace()
[all...]
H A Dcfg.rs4 use crate::syntax::Api;
24 apis: &mut Vec<Api>,
29 Api::Struct(strct) => strct
32 Api::Enum(enm) => enm
111 impl Api { impls
114 Api::Include(include) => &include.cfg, in cfg()
115 Api::Struct(strct) => &strct.cfg, in cfg()
116 Api::Enum(enm) => &enm.cfg, in cfg()
117 Api::CxxType(ety) | Api in cfg()
[all...]
H A Dnested.rs2 use crate::syntax::Api;
6 direct: Vec<&'a Api>,
11 pub fn new(apis: Vec<&'a Api>) -> Self { in new()
15 pub fn direct_content(&self) -> &[&'a Api] { in new()
24 fn sort_by_inner_namespace(apis: Vec<&Api>, depth: usize) -> NamespaceEntries { in sort_by_inner_namespace()
57 use crate::syntax::{Api, Doc, ExternType, ForeignName, Lang, Lifetimes, Pair};
121 fn assert_ident(api: &Api, expected: &str) { in assert_ident()
122 if let Api::CxxType(cxx_type) = api { in assert_ident()
129 fn make_api(ns: Option<&str>, ident: &str) -> Api { in make_api()
131 Api in make_api()
[all...]
/third_party/rust/crates/cxx/gen/build/src/gen/
H A Dnamespace.rs2 use crate::syntax::Api;
4 impl Api { impls
7 Api::CxxFunction(efn) | Api::RustFunction(efn) => &efn.name.namespace, in namespace()
8 Api::CxxType(ety) | Api::RustType(ety) => &ety.name.namespace, in namespace()
9 Api::Enum(enm) => &enm.name.namespace, in namespace()
10 Api::Struct(strct) => &strct.name.namespace, in namespace()
11 Api::Impl(_) | Api in namespace()
[all...]
H A Dcfg.rs4 use crate::syntax::Api;
24 apis: &mut Vec<Api>,
29 Api::Struct(strct) => strct
32 Api::Enum(enm) => enm
111 impl Api { impls
114 Api::Include(include) => &include.cfg, in cfg()
115 Api::Struct(strct) => &strct.cfg, in cfg()
116 Api::Enum(enm) => &enm.cfg, in cfg()
117 Api::CxxType(ety) | Api in cfg()
[all...]
H A Dnested.rs2 use crate::syntax::Api;
6 direct: Vec<&'a Api>,
11 pub fn new(apis: Vec<&'a Api>) -> Self { in new()
15 pub fn direct_content(&self) -> &[&'a Api] { in new()
24 fn sort_by_inner_namespace(apis: Vec<&Api>, depth: usize) -> NamespaceEntries { in sort_by_inner_namespace()
57 use crate::syntax::{Api, Doc, ExternType, ForeignName, Lang, Lifetimes, Pair};
121 fn assert_ident(api: &Api, expected: &str) { in assert_ident()
122 if let Api::CxxType(cxx_type) = api { in assert_ident()
129 fn make_api(ns: Option<&str>, ident: &str) -> Api { in make_api()
131 Api in make_api()
[all...]
/third_party/rust/crates/cxx/gen/build/src/syntax/
H A Dident.rs2 use crate::syntax::{error, Api, Pair};
27 pub(crate) fn check_all(cx: &mut Check, apis: &[Api]) {
30 Api::Include(_) | Api::Impl(_) => {}
31 Api::Struct(strct) => {
37 Api::Enum(enm) => {
43 Api::CxxType(ety) | Api::RustType(ety) => {
46 Api::CxxFunction(efn) | Api
[all...]
H A Dtypes.rs10 toposort, Api, Atom, Enum, EnumRepr, ExternType, Impl, Lifetimes, Pair, Struct, Type, TypeAlias,
31 pub fn collect(cx: &mut Errors, apis: &'a [Api]) -> Self { in collect()
71 Api::Include(_) => {}
72 Api::Struct(strct) => {
90 Api::Enum(enm) => {
117 Api::CxxType(ety) => {
134 Api::RustType(ety) => {
142 Api::CxxFunction(efn) | Api::RustFunction(efn) => {
155 Api
[all...]
/third_party/rust/crates/cxx/gen/lib/src/syntax/
H A Dident.rs2 use crate::syntax::{error, Api, Pair};
27 pub(crate) fn check_all(cx: &mut Check, apis: &[Api]) {
30 Api::Include(_) | Api::Impl(_) => {}
31 Api::Struct(strct) => {
37 Api::Enum(enm) => {
43 Api::CxxType(ety) | Api::RustType(ety) => {
46 Api::CxxFunction(efn) | Api
[all...]
H A Dtypes.rs10 toposort, Api, Atom, Enum, EnumRepr, ExternType, Impl, Lifetimes, Pair, Struct, Type, TypeAlias,
31 pub fn collect(cx: &mut Errors, apis: &'a [Api]) -> Self { in collect()
71 Api::Include(_) => {}
72 Api::Struct(strct) => {
90 Api::Enum(enm) => {
117 Api::CxxType(ety) => {
134 Api::RustType(ety) => {
142 Api::CxxFunction(efn) | Api::RustFunction(efn) => {
155 Api
[all...]
/third_party/rust/crates/cxx/macro/src/syntax/
H A Dident.rs2 use crate::syntax::{error, Api, Pair};
27 pub(crate) fn check_all(cx: &mut Check, apis: &[Api]) {
30 Api::Include(_) | Api::Impl(_) => {}
31 Api::Struct(strct) => {
37 Api::Enum(enm) => {
43 Api::CxxType(ety) | Api::RustType(ety) => {
46 Api::CxxFunction(efn) | Api
[all...]
H A Dtypes.rs10 toposort, Api, Atom, Enum, EnumRepr, ExternType, Impl, Lifetimes, Pair, Struct, Type, TypeAlias,
31 pub fn collect(cx: &mut Errors, apis: &'a [Api]) -> Self { in collect()
71 Api::Include(_) => {}
72 Api::Struct(strct) => {
90 Api::Enum(enm) => {
117 Api::CxxType(ety) => {
134 Api::RustType(ety) => {
142 Api::CxxFunction(efn) | Api::RustFunction(efn) => {
155 Api
[all...]
/third_party/rust/crates/cxx/syntax/
H A Dident.rs2 use crate::syntax::{error, Api, Pair};
27 pub(crate) fn check_all(cx: &mut Check, apis: &[Api]) {
30 Api::Include(_) | Api::Impl(_) => {}
31 Api::Struct(strct) => {
37 Api::Enum(enm) => {
43 Api::CxxType(ety) | Api::RustType(ety) => {
46 Api::CxxFunction(efn) | Api
[all...]
H A Dtypes.rs10 toposort, Api, Atom, Enum, EnumRepr, ExternType, Impl, Lifetimes, Pair, Struct, Type, TypeAlias,
31 pub fn collect(cx: &mut Errors, apis: &'a [Api]) -> Self { in collect()
71 Api::Include(_) => {}
72 Api::Struct(strct) => {
90 Api::Enum(enm) => {
117 Api::CxxType(ety) => {
134 Api::RustType(ety) => {
142 Api::CxxFunction(efn) | Api::RustFunction(efn) => {
155 Api
[all...]
/third_party/rust/crates/cxx/gen/cmd/src/syntax/
H A Dident.rs2 use crate::syntax::{error, Api, Pair};
27 pub(crate) fn check_all(cx: &mut Check, apis: &[Api]) {
30 Api::Include(_) | Api::Impl(_) => {}
31 Api::Struct(strct) => {
37 Api::Enum(enm) => {
43 Api::CxxType(ety) | Api::RustType(ety) => {
46 Api::CxxFunction(efn) | Api
[all...]
H A Dtypes.rs10 toposort, Api, Atom, Enum, EnumRepr, ExternType, Impl, Lifetimes, Pair, Struct, Type, TypeAlias,
31 pub fn collect(cx: &mut Errors, apis: &'a [Api]) -> Self { in collect()
71 Api::Include(_) => {}
72 Api::Struct(strct) => {
90 Api::Enum(enm) => {
117 Api::CxxType(ety) => {
134 Api::RustType(ety) => {
142 Api::CxxFunction(efn) | Api::RustFunction(efn) => {
155 Api
[all...]
/third_party/protobuf/src/google/protobuf/
H A Dapi.pb.h60 class Api;
71 template<> PROTOBUF_EXPORT PROTOBUF_NAMESPACE_ID::Api* Arena::CreateMaybeMessage<PROTOBUF_NAMESPACE_ID::Api>(Arena*);
79 class PROTOBUF_EXPORT Api PROTOBUF_FINAL :
80 public ::PROTOBUF_NAMESPACE_ID::Message /* @@protoc_insertion_point(class_definition:google.protobuf.Api) */ {
82 inline Api() : Api(nullptr) {} in Api() function in PROTOBUF_FINAL
83 virtual ~Api();
85 Api(const Api
87 : Api() { Api() function in PROTOBUF_FINAL
[all...]
H A Dapi.pb.cc24 ::PROTOBUF_NAMESPACE_ID::internal::ExplicitlyConstructed<Api> _instance;
40 new (ptr) PROTOBUF_NAMESPACE_ID::Api(); in InitDefaultsscc_info_Api_google_2fprotobuf_2fapi_2eproto()
43 PROTOBUF_NAMESPACE_ID::Api::InitAsDefaultInstance(); in InitDefaultsscc_info_Api_google_2fprotobuf_2fapi_2eproto()
88 PROTOBUF_FIELD_OFFSET(PROTOBUF_NAMESPACE_ID::Api, _internal_metadata_),
92 PROTOBUF_FIELD_OFFSET(PROTOBUF_NAMESPACE_ID::Api, name_),
93 PROTOBUF_FIELD_OFFSET(PROTOBUF_NAMESPACE_ID::Api, methods_),
94 PROTOBUF_FIELD_OFFSET(PROTOBUF_NAMESPACE_ID::Api, options_),
95 PROTOBUF_FIELD_OFFSET(PROTOBUF_NAMESPACE_ID::Api, version_),
96 PROTOBUF_FIELD_OFFSET(PROTOBUF_NAMESPACE_ID::Api, source_context_),
97 PROTOBUF_FIELD_OFFSET(PROTOBUF_NAMESPACE_ID::Api, mixins
197 Api::Api(::PROTOBUF_NAMESPACE_ID::Arena* arena) Api() function in Api
206 Api::Api(const Api& from) Api() function in Api
[all...]

Completed in 11 milliseconds

123